Maze Puzzle

Blumenlaby  (Flowers Labyrinth) – a maze with a twist – literally!  This two-level maze will have you scratching your head and having you see double.  The two flower wheels spin on a central axis, allowing the ball to travel between the two layers.  It is like solving two labyrinths simultaneously and then some!  For the truly dedicated puzzler!

This was the one that I had fun playing with. My kids were busy with the Cugolino Wooden Marble Run and the Bibros Building Blocks so I grabbed this and gave it a try. It’s super fun to twist and turn and move the marble around the maze. I didn’t have any rhyme or reason for how I was moving it around, just thought I’d give it a go. I enjoyed trying to find a way for the marble to get out and actually did manage to solve it.

Our youngest daughter picked up the Blumenlaby today and actually studied it so she could figure it out. And she sure did. I think she solved it faster than I did. 😉

The Blumenlaby is not only fun but it also has a beautiful design. I can see us sitting this on the end table in the living room when we’re not playing with it. Whenever you need a little play time, just pick it up!
